Daniel Cawrey | CoinDesk.com
Bitcoin payment processor GoCoin has raised $550,000 in venture capital to expand its operations.
GoCoin’s seed round was funded by a group of investors, most notably Owen Van Natta, a former Chief Operating Officer of Facebook who has also held positions at Amazon and Zynga.
BitAngels, a distributed angel fund that has invested in a number of BTC-based startups, has also participated in the round.
